Hwy 59 Crash Victim Identified

A collision between a tractor and Honda Civic claimed the life of a Wellesley man. His passenger a 5 year old boy has survived.

TAVISTOCK - One man is dead after a Friday evening crash between a car and a tractor towing a grain bin. A Honda Civic was driving northbound on Highway 59 when it ran into the back of a grain bin being towed by a tractor. The Civic spun out of control and into the oncoming path of a Dodge pick-up truck. The male driver of the Honda Civic was pronounced dead at the scene and the 5 year old passenger was transported to hospital with non-life threatening injuries. 

The female driver of the pick-up was also sent to hospital non-life threatening injuries. While the driver of the tractor suffered no injuries. 

The deceased driver of the Honda Civic has been identifed as 40 year old Scott Draper of Wellesley.

OPP are investigating the cause of the crash.
